Short Presentation

Camille Cosby is an American television producer, author, and philanthropist, widely recognized for her involvement in various educational and cultural initiatives. She is also known as the wife of comedian Bill Cosby.

Early Life

Camille Olivia Hanks was born on March 20, 1944, in Washington, D.C. She grew up in a well-educated family, with her father being a chemist and her mother a nursery teacher. She attended Catholic schools and later graduated from the University of Maryland with a degree in psychology.

Personal Life

Camille married Bill Cosby in 1964, and together they have five children. Despite facing public scrutiny due to her husband's legal issues, Camille has stood by him and continues to focus on her philanthropic and cultural endeavors.

Professional Life

Camille Cosby has produced several television shows and documentaries, including the critically acclaimed "The Cosby Show." She has also authored books and is deeply involved in philanthropic activities, particularly in education and the arts.
